Lucas Tyree Kunce (/ k uː n t s / KOONTS; born October 6, 1982) [1] is an American attorney, Marine veteran, and politician. He was the Democratic nominee for the 2024 United States Senate election in Missouri, losing to Republican incumbent Josh Hawley. [2] [3] Before entering politics, Kunce was in the United States Marine Corps.
